Certificates, letters and newspaper cuttings relating to Thomas Arthur Bassett, 1915-1920.

Certificates and letters relating to Bassett’s appointments in the Royal Naval Reserve and his transport duties at Newhaven, Liverpool and Portsmouth in 1915-1918. Also a handwritten summary of his services in the period 1903-1918. Letters sent to Mrs Helen M. Bassett, with condolences and discussion of her late husband’s entitlement to a war bonus and medals. Including a letter of condolence from Admiral Stanley C.J. Colville, Commander-in-Chief at Portsmouth, dated 30 September 1918. Five newspaper cuttings with articles about Bassett's death and funeral, published in September and October 1918.
